What Is A Pulse Oximeter (Fingertip)?

A fingertip pulse oximeter is a compact, non-invasive medical device designed to accurately measure two critical physiological parameters: blood oxygen saturation (SpO2) and pulse rate. It works by emitting two specific wavelengths of light – red and infrared – through a translucent part of the body, typically a fingertip. Hemoglobin, the protein in red blood cells responsible for oxygen transport, absorbs these wavelengths differently depending on whether it is bound to oxygen (oxyhemoglobin) or not (deoxyhemoglobin). The device's sensor detects the transmitted light and, through sophisticated algorithms, calculates the percentage of hemoglobin saturated with oxygen. Simultaneously, it detects the pulsatile changes in blood flow, allowing for the determination of the heart rate.

  • Measurement of Blood Oxygen Saturation (SpO2): Quantifies the percentage of hemoglobin carrying oxygen, a key indicator of respiratory function.
  • Measurement of Pulse Rate: Determines the number of heartbeats per minute, reflecting cardiovascular status.
  • Non-invasive and Painless: Utilizes light transmission for measurement, eliminating the need for blood draws.
  • Portable and User-Friendly: Small size and simple operation allow for quick deployment and use by healthcare professionals in diverse environments.

Calibration Requirements

Fingertip pulse oximeters are generally factory-calibrated and designed for direct clinical use without the need for user-performed calibration. However, it is crucial to perform regular functional checks to ensure accuracy and reliability. These checks involve placing the oximeter on a healthy individual (if possible and appropriate) and observing if the readings are within the expected physiological range (e.g., SpO2 between 95-100% and pulse rate between 60-100 bpm). Any deviations or suspected inaccuracies should prompt a device review or servicing. Refer to the manufacturer's guidelines for recommended functional check frequencies and procedures. For critical applications or after potential impact, a professional diagnostic check may be required.
